Gary Bettman - Education and Family

Education and Family

Bettman was born in Queens, New York. He studied Industrial and Labor Relations at Cornell University in Ithaca, New York, where he was a brother of the Alpha Epsilon Pi Fraternity, and graduated in 1974. After receiving a Juris Doctor degree from New York University School of Law in 1977, Bettman joined the New York City law firm of Proskauer Rose Goetz & Mendelsohn.

Bettman is Jewish and lives with his wife, Shelli, and their three children Lauren, Jordan, and Brittany. He is a resident of Saddle River, New Jersey. Half brother Jeffrey Pollack was the Commissioner of the World Series of Poker.
